Two new phenanthroindolizidine alkaloids, lepicarpine A ( 1 ) and lepicarpine B ( 2 ), along with two known compounds, (+)-6-demethyltylocrebrine ( 3 ) and (+)-6-demethyltylophorine ( 4 ), were isolated from the leaves of Ficus lepicarpa . Their chemical structures and absolute configurations were elucidated through comprehensive spectroscopic analyses. In vitro cytotoxicity assays revealed that all four compounds exhibited antiproliferative activity against human cancer cell lines. Compound 1 showed pronounced selectivity toward colorectal adenocarcinoma SW48 cells (IC 50 0.66 μM), demonstrating 10-fold greater potency than 5-fluorouracil. Notably, compound 2 exhibited the most potent and broad-spectrum cytotoxic activity, with IC 50 values of 0.05 μM (SW48), 0.64 μM (Caco-2), and 0.17 μM (H1299), achieving potency comparable to doxorubicin against SW48 cells and significantly surpassing 5-fluorouracil across all tested cell lines. The occurrence of phenanthroindolizidine alkaloids in F. lepicarpa further supports their chemotaxonomic association with Section Sycocarpus of Subgenus Sycomorus . • Two new phenanthroindolizidine alkaloids were isolated from Ficus lepicarpa • Lepicarpine B showed exceptional cytotoxicity (IC 50 0.05 μM) against SW48 cells. • The occurrence of phenanthroindolizidines supports Section Sycocarpus affiliation.
